Post subject: Pre Match and Game On. NAB Challenge - Pies v. DogsReply with quote

Date: Saturday March 21 2015
Stadium: Etihad Stadium, Docklands
Start: 7:10pm (AEDT)

Our last practice match for the pre-season takes place this Saturday night against the Bulldogs at Etihad Stadium.

The biggest question heading into this match is how we will line-up. I suspect Bucks and the coaching staff will decide to play a near full-strength side as we won't be playing for another two weeks after this match so we need all the match fitness that we can gain before round 1.

After a disappointing effort on Sunday we need to see more intensity around the contest, better forward line delivery and of course aim to sustain no more injuries before the season officially begins two weeks later.

The Bulldogs have lost a lot of experienced players during the off-season and with Tom Liberatore gone for the season with a knee injury I think they'll struggle this season as a whole. They beat a reserves Richmond side in their first practice match and fell short against Melbourne despite trailing by about 50 points at one stage against them on Saturday. The Bulldogs will benefit from an extra days break but that shouldn't make a difference overall heading into this game.

I expect us to win but I'm really hoping that we start fine tuning our structures and mindset heading into the season now. I suspect this game will be taken most seriously out of the three pre-season matches we have this year.

27 named in that squad, so if this is the "shortlist" for round 1, there's still 5 to come out of that squad, even without any other changes.

Looking at the 27, you'd think the 5 "outs" for round 1 would be between Fasolo, Kennedy, Gault, Blair, Thomas, Williams, Broomhead, Ramsay, Karnezis and Oxley. So, Williams, Ramsay and Oxley are probably after the same back-line spot (or, perhaps, 2 backline spots, if Goldy doesn't play as a defender (assuming Frost, Langdon, Brown and Toovey are all starters), Fas, Gault, Blair and PK are probably fighting it out for one taller (assuming Goldy plays back) and one smaller forward spot (the 'Pies normally play only a five-man forward set-up and Cloke, White and Elliott will almost certainly start). That leaves two mid-field spots between BenKen, Thomas and Broomy (although BenKen or Broomy might also get a goal-sneak roll if they don't get selected as mid-fielders). So, with those odds, you'd be looking for some would-be forwards to have big days, especially after some of the shooting for goal last week.

Absent a rash of injuries, there is, plainly, a lot of pressure for spots, especially given that a number of solid or better footballers (Dwyer, Reid, Witts) and excellent prospects (Shaz, De Goey, Freeman) aren't in the list.
